Learning Org
Learning Org
• Where people continually expand their capacity to create the results they truly
desire
• Where new patterns of thinking are nurtured
• Where collective aspiration is set free
• Where people are continually learning to see the whole together
• “When you ask people about what it is like being part of a great team, what is
most striking is the meaningfulness of the experience. People talk about being
part of something larger than themselves, of being connected, of being
generative.”
(Senge 1990: 13)
• The learning organization and organizational learning are
slightly different in that the learning organization is the process
to change and organizational learning is having the process and
strategies and implementing change throughout an
organization. Simply put, one is the plan, the other is the
action.
